A Custom Algorithm Is Only as Good as the Planning Around It

By Phil Cowlishaw, Managing Director, Adobe Advertising

Custom algorithms are becoming a more important part of programmatic buying as advertisers look for ways to make media optimization reflect their own business goals and data. A model built around an advertiser’s specific signals will make bidding more relevant to the outcomes the business values most.

That said, custom algorithms alone do not guarantee better performance. When a campaign disappoints, teams often scrutinize the model first. In practice, the cause may be a poorly defined goal, too little data, an unrealistic target, or a campaign setup that limits what the algorithm can accomplish.

To achieve the best results with custom algorithms, advertisers should work through six areas in sequence.

1. Define the outcome precisely

A model needs a clear objective before it can be evaluated fairly. “Drive purchases” is too broad. Teams should identify the exact conversion event, agree on the primary KPI and target CPA, and document where the measurement signal comes from.

The attribution window should also be settled before launch, along with the campaign variables that will remain fixed during the evaluation. If goals or measurement rules keep changing, it becomes difficult to isolate the model’s impact.

2. Make sure there is enough signal

Signal volume and history need to be assessed before launch. As a rough floor, advertisers should look for at least 100 organic goal events per day and about 45 days of goal-event history. If retargeting is part of the strategy, roughly 45 days of audience history is useful as well.

 Conversion timing matters too. The shorter the path from decision to action, the faster the algorithm can learn which signals are associated with a successful outcome and optimize accordingly. For products with longer purchase cycles, advertisers should consider identifying meaningful intermediate actions, such as qualified visits, applications or other high-intent behaviors, that provide the model with more frequent feedback while still pointing toward the ultimate conversion.

A lack of DSP-attributed conversions at launch does not necessarily prevent a model from getting started. A strong organic conversion signal can provide enough information for initial learning.

3. Pressure-test the target and campaign

An algorithm can only optimize within the opportunity available to it. Before launch, advertisers should assess whether the target CPA is achievable given the audience, budget, and campaign design.

That starts with the audience. Teams should understand its size and reachability and how recently it has been refreshed. They should also examine the balance between retargeting and prospecting and whether lookalike expansion could add scale.

The campaign can impose limits as well. Attribution events need to fire correctly and map to the intended goals. Creative should fit the formats being bought. Targeting should leave enough room for delivery. Budgets, pacing, and bids should support the desired scale. Inventory and deal availability also need to match expectations.

If those conditions do not support the CPA goal, that should be surfaced before the test begins. Adjusting the target or campaign design upfront produces a more useful evaluation than asking the algorithm to overcome a structural constraint.

4. Build a fair comparison

Head-to-head platform tests are useful only when the conditions are comparable. Audiences and geographies should be equivalent, creative and flight dates should be aligned, and budgets should generally remain within about 5 to 10 percent of each other. Both sides should use the same attribution and conversion windows.

Core variables should remain stable throughout the test. Changing the conversion event, CPA goal, channel mix, or fundamental targeting midway through makes the result harder to interpret.

 When adding a new platform or partner, the most important question may be whether it creates incremental value. Two platforms can appear to perform well while effectively competing for the same pool of likely converters. A meaningful test should examine whether the new partner is finding additional conversions and expanding the total opportunity available to the advertiser.

If there is no incumbent and the algorithm is being tested against a performance target, strict platform parity is unnecessary. The benchmark and measurement assumptions still need to be locked before launch.

5. Give the model time to learn

Custom algorithms begin working immediately, but the effect may take time to appear in reported performance. Conversion lag means impressions served today may not produce measurable outcomes for days or weeks.

In many campaigns, meaningful movement in CPA does not become visible for two to three weeks. Early data is useful for spotting delivery or measurement problems, but a formal judgment should come only after the agreed attribution window and post-spend conversion lag have passed.

6. Refine one constraint at a time

Once enough data has accumulated, optimization should become more targeted. Thin conversion volume may point to signal quality or coverage. Limited scale may require audience expansion or refinement. Delivery problems may call for changes to campaign configuration.

The key is to make changes deliberately. Altering several major inputs at once may improve performance, but it also obscures what caused the improvement. Changing one meaningful variable at a time creates a clearer learning loop.

Custom algorithms can give advertisers a more direct way to translate their own signals and business priorities into media decisions. Their value depends on disciplined execution.

The best results will come from treating custom algorithms as an ongoing operating discipline. Define the outcome, establish the conditions for learning, measure carefully, and refine based on evidence. That is what turns a custom algorithm into a repeatable performance advantage.
